在数据管理中,分区表丢失是一个常见且令人头疼的问题。这不仅影响了数据的完整性,还可能带来业务中断的严重后果。当分区表丢失时,我们该如何恢复呢?以下是一些详细的方法和步骤,帮助你解决这一难题。
 
一、检查备份
1.检查是否有最近的数据库备份。如果有的话,这是恢复分区表的最直接方法。
2.确认备份的完整性和有效性,确保备份中包含丢失的分区表。
 
二、使用数据库恢复工具
1.许多数据库管理系统(如MySQL、Oracle等)都提供了恢复工具。
2.使用这些工具,你可以根据备份文件恢复分区表。
 
三、手动重建分区表
1.如果没有备份或者备份不可用,你可能需要手动重建分区表。
2.这通常涉及到以下步骤:
-确定分区表的结构,包括字段、数据类型等。
-创建一个新的分区表,使用与原表相同或相似的结构。
-将数据从备份或临时表中复制到新创建的分区表中。
 
四、利用数据库日志
1.如果数据库启用了日志记录功能,可以利用日志来恢复分区表。
2.通过分析日志文件,你可以找到分区表丢失前的最后一条记录。
3.使用这些记录来重建分区表。
 
五、使用第三方数据恢复工具
1.市面上有许多第三方数据恢复工具,如EasyRecovery、DiskDrill等。
2.这些工具通常具有强大的数据恢复能力,可以帮助你恢复丢失的分区表。
 
六、联系技术支持
1.如果上述方法都无法解决问题,可以联系数据库的技术支持团队。
2.他们可能会提供更专业的解决方案。
 
七、预防措施
1.定期备份数据库,尤其是分区表。
2.对数据库进行定期检查,确保数据的完整性和一致性。
 
八、
分区表丢失虽然令人头疼,但通过上述方法,我们可以有效地恢复数据。记住,预防胜于治疗,定期备份和检查是避免此类问题的最佳策略。
 
九、个人观点
在处理分区表丢失的问题时,保持冷静和耐心至关重要。通过深入了解数据库结构和恢复机制,我们可以更好地应对这类挑战。
 
十、情感投入
想象一下,当你发现分区表丢失时的焦虑和无奈。但请相信,只要我们采取正确的步骤,总能找到解决问题的方法。希望这篇文章能为你提供一些实用的指导,让你在面对类似问题时更加从容不迫。